    <title>Repayment of ‘7.37% GS 2023’</title>
    <link>https://www.taxtmi.com/news?id=26415</link>
    <description>Repayment of Government Securities at scheduled maturity is payable at par and interest ceases from that date; if the repayment day is a holiday under the Negotiable Instruments Act, 1881, paying offices in the State will repay on the previous working day. Registered holders in Subsidiary General Ledger, Constituent Subsidiary General Ledger or by Stock Certificate will be paid by pay order incorporating bank account particulars or by electronic credit, and must submit bank particulars in advance; absent those particulars, holders may tender duly discharged securities at Public Debt Offices, Treasuries/Sub Treasuries or specified bank branches for repayment.</description>
